I dont really have any goss on Bucks other than having met his wife on a number of occasions. Shes all class. He is a freak in that he can deliver on either foot over 50m. It can hurt teams. Not many guys can do that even today. Most of the boys will be looking huge this time of year. Generally they will be in the middle of a fierce weights rotation. Most of them will carry 4-5kgs in muscle into a season and the grind of the week to weel will strip that off. They will be looking for their ideal weights around July. Whitnall is my vintage. Peaked at age 17. Absolute freak. He could eat pies all day as kid and his body would deal with it. They slow your metabolism and pump you full of creatine and the rest and that has been a disaster for him.
JM George Gregan is one of the most powerful athletes in the world. You do realise this? His power/weight ratio is off the charts. He IS a freak. Most AFL guys would love to beef up but getting turned inside out by daniel wells and made to look like a fool in front of 50,000 folk isnt fun for anyone. Muscle is over-rated in AFL.Power/weight is critical but its more becoming a game of 'keepings off' so speed and accuracy of ball movement is more critical than say 10 years ago.
